Set against the background of Chile's bloody coup in 1973,
when Pinochet's military junta overthrew the Allende socialist
government, this is the story of how two boys, one from
the privileged suburbs and the other a shanty-town slum-dweller,
become classmates and friends. As the outside world impinges
on their lives, their school, and the lives of their friends
and families, we witness a society verging on civil war.
The settings - school, shanty-town, bourgeois villa, Santiago
- are finely-depicted, the camerawork creates images that
will live with you for years, and the performances of all
the young actors are immensely impressive.
